Do you have plans to learn new crochet stitches in the new year? This project will have you learning some fun linked crochet stitches. Linked stitches are just like regular stitches except they don’t produce all the holes normally associated with tall stitches. Have you tried using a double ended crochet hook yet? The hooks are the same size and you use two separate balls of yarn. This allows you to change colors on every row without cutting off at each color change. Crochet: Washcloth / Dishcloth
These fun bath scrubs are made in fine nylon cord. The nylon has a dual purpose. It doesn’t retain water like cotton so there is less chance of mildew. And, the nylon cord is great for exfoliating. The Omega thread I used for these projects is available in 90 different colors and can be purchased online at Creative Yarn Source.
